微信号:dellemc_tech

介绍:为戴尔易安信客户提供技术支持服务,为广大IT行业用户分享技术文章与行业信息。

2017年软件趋势

2017-02-23 17:22 EMC中文技术社区

    


     在Pivotal,我们从许多角度看软件。我们帮助财富100强公司,如福特,通用电气和Liberty Mutual过渡到更加面向软件,我们帮助像HelloGbye和ModCloth这样的创业公司制造他们的产品和扩展他们的团队。我们还建立和维护我们自己的软件,从Pivotal Cloud Foundry和Pivotal Tracker到一些令人难以置信的开源技术,如Spring,Greenplum等。


     我们汇集了一些最聪明的人才,展望2017年对软件本身以及它所影响的一些行业的看法。这些声音包括Pivotal员工,Pivotal客户,以及来自其他领先技术专家的几位客人。希望这些见解可以帮助您和您的团队领先于未来,并构建比以前更好,更快,更安全,更有价值的软件。

 

汽车


     我们将看到这个行业的许多有趣的发展,而其中由特斯拉开始的突破。显然,我们将看到更多的自动驾驶汽车的推出,但我们也将看到整个联网汽车系统变得“聪明”。比如可以期望你的车能够预测一个部件的故障,并建议一些方便的时间去拜访机械师进行维护,并告诉你谁会有替换部件!

- Kaushik Das,Pivotal数据科学主管

 


大数据


     过去几年,三大趋势塑造了应用程序开发:云计算,敏捷和DevOps。在2017年,我们将看到这些趋势以指向数据。我们已经看到云计算在分离计算和数据的架构中的效果。基于云计算的blob(二进制大对象)存储(如S3)已成为许多组织的新数据湖。敏捷实践将越来越多地影响数据工程师和数据科学家的工作,使他们能够受益于快速反馈周期和持续交付价值。最后,我们将看到数据库管理员利用DevOps实践来自动化其数据服务的部署和编排,由像Pivotal Cloud Foundry的数据服务这样的产品支持,这些服务通过自动化实现开发人员自助服务。

- Elisabeth Hendrickson,Pivotal大数据工程副总裁

 


云计算


     在彭博社,我们在全球资本市场的地位推动我们了解极端网络和系统可用性的独特需求。然而,许多不同行业的公司尚未(完全)了解这些要求。随着越来越多的组织将其关键任务系统迁移到云端,我们预计2017年可能会发生一些大规模事件(例如服务中断,DDOS攻击等),导致企业意识到实施多云战略。我们相信,企业将需要传播他们的芯片,并利用多个云提供商实现最佳的可用性。

- Bloomberg LP计算架构主管Justin Erenkrantz


     2017将看到In-Memory Data Grids(IMDG)成为云本机应用程序生态系统的一个组成部分。尽管IMDG的使用在历史上一直是利基服务市场,需要复杂的实时事件处理,如欺诈检测- 在2017年,他们在高度分布式,自适应的云本机应用程序中的作用将带来他们主流。无论是用于聚集有界上下文数据集合,还是作为CQRS模式中的一个层,简化的消费和编程模型将使IMGD可供主流开发人员使用。

- Cornelia Davis,Pivotal公司技术总监

 


连续集成


     每个参与应用程序开发的人都认为持续集成(CI)是一个真正的好主意。然而,如果相信调查,只有大约40%的组织持续集成。管理坚持DevOps和云本地的优势,为质量更好的软件提供生产更频繁地推动可用性和创新。将CI置于适当位置是第一个必要的要求,因此,这意味着预期有60%缺少CI的机构和组织将在今年将其置于适当位置,使他们进一步沿着提供更好的软件的路径。

- MichaelCoté,Pivotal技术营销总监

 


数据科学

    

     在2017年,企业将越来越多地从集中的共享服务向数据科学组织转移,倾向于将数据科学家直接嵌入业务部门,甚至使数据科学家成为软件开发项目团队的一部分。这将导致更好的软件,利用数据科学来支持“智能”功能,如个性化的建议和智能自动化。

- Jeff Kelly,Pivotal首席产品营销经理

 


设计


     服务设计将成为主流,使其他人 - 超越设计师- 将知道它,并开始拥抱和使用它。服务设计是各种UX设计,通过将用户体验映射出来并将其链接到各种服务系统来考虑用户的整体体验; 声音,信息亭,标牌,软件 - 什么真的。它在设计和商业社区已经存在了25年,现在正转向软件。在Pivotal,我们有一个强大的服务蓝图的实践,重点是链接软件层和用户体验。

- Kim Dowd,Pivotal设计实践主管

 


构架


     如果应用程序允许并集成它,平台可以做更多。以同样的方式,在iOS或Windows或Android上的最佳应用程序利用底层平台,期望看到应用程序依赖于更大的平台服务补充,并相应地利用API。但是这些集成不是业务差异化的功能,所以期望看到框架处理越来越多的责任,释放开发人员专注于手头的业务逻辑。Spring Cloud(基于Spring Boot)是适用于您的云操作系统的win32 API,这种集成将继续改进。随着组织建立更大的系统,系统中组件之间的通信的可靠性将增加,并且消息和异步通信的价值也将增加。期待在2017年强烈关注反应式编程和异步编程。

- Josh Long,Spring Developer Advocate,Pivotal

 


政府


     软件将成为更有效和更高效的政府背后的驱动力。目前,软件支持我们的操作。在未来,软件(系统)的卓越运营将是我们对社会的价值主张的核心。同时,开源和开放标准的日益重要性将使政府能够建立和参与作为智能网络的灵活的生态系统 - 政府,公民和公司之间的灵活联盟,为整个社会创造价值。

- Perry van der Weyden,首席信息官,Rijkswaterstaat

 


微服务


     “微服务”几年前进入了我们的词典,但是他们主导了关于下一代软件的话题。但是我们将在2017年在路上碰到一些颠簸。有几个服务,如修补,日志记录和容量扩展工作正常,当你有成千上万的时候不能工作得很好。随着公司重组,我们将看到一个简短的“失败之谷”,它解决了如何获得微服务和容器的好处,而不会使IT部门陷入混乱。

- Pivotal公司产品高级总监Richard Seroter

 

     微服务将在2017年正式跨越鸿沟,今年将有多家财富500强公司通过微服务架构部署关键的参与系统。许多微服务实现将摆脱他们的REST / JSON开始,并真正拥抱事件驱动的体系结构,最困难的问题由事件源和CQRS实现解决。同时,无服务器/功能作为服务(FaaS)的炒作波将开始其曲棍球攀登作为继承人显然对微服务,客户将开始探索这种按需计算范例的可能的用例。他们将开始向Big 3(Amazon,Google,Microsoft)提供商施加压力,以改进他们的FaaS产品,包括改进的开发人员体验,测试和CI / CD促进,以及一系列触发产品,服务收入。

- Matt Stine,战略产品负责人 - Spring,Pivotal

 


移动


     你的手机将拥抱增强现实。口袋妖怪GO激发了它,但AR来到你的智能手机的各个方面。通过位置数据,快速网络和基于云的服务,通过软件进行机器学习的能力将使提供商获得我们一生中最大的学习和预测能力。他们会明智地选择什么和什么时候与你分享吗?与伟大的软件将承担巨大的责任。寻找您的智能手机成为一个更聪明的顾问。

- Mark D'Cunha,移动和云平台,Pivotal

 


可观察性


     远离yore的庞然大物,今天的架构是灵活的,开发人员驱动,并且不重要的故障排除。无论我们使用分布式跟踪工具还是通过即席查询启用深入内省,调试当今的分布式系统意味着解决分形复杂性。现代工具的可观测性的未来使我们能够成功与微服务和功能作为服务的架构模式。

- Bridget Kromhout,首席技术专家,Pivotal

 


产品管理


     产品管理(PM)社区将变得更加强大和多样化。因为拥有不同视角和经验的团队制作更好的产品,我对“Women In Product Slack”(一个充满活力和热情的Slack团体)特别感兴趣,该团队旨在为高度性别的角色和行业带来更多的多样性和包容性。PM角色也将变得更具战略性。随着企业领导者与IT同行合作并与其合作,使软件成为价值引擎(而不是外包支持功能),PM角色将更加融入战略,产品定义和产品设计的工作中。对于收集和沟通业务需求以及更多地定义正确的结果,以及与团队朝着正确的解决方案进行迭代,这将更少。影响:更多地强调通过产品(而不是按时,按预算)交付正确的可量化的客户和业务价值,基于结果的计划(而不是基于解决方案的计划),以及强化精益和敏捷产品团队(而不是敏捷项目团队)。

- Joanna Beltowska,Pivotal产品管理副总监

 


零售:健康美容


     这将是一个个性化的竞赛。健康和美容产业是巨大的,但现在,它完全基于大品牌的主观想法。行业需要开始认识到消费者独特的健康和美容需求,一刀切的不能工作。新兴技术将使我们能够根据每个客户的独特需求打造产品和体验。尊重客户是沃克公司的核心价值,我们希望在这里领先。

- Tristan Walker,Walker&Company品牌创始人兼首席执行官

 


社交媒体


     数据驱动你最喜欢的事业的决定。非营利组织将分享更多关于其成功和失败的数据,以提高其工作的透明度和信心。易于访问的实时分析将取代在您打开桌面时过时的研究报告。越来越多的这些数据将在移动设备领域中收集。将实施机器学习和其他工具,以确保数据不仅仅被收集,而且实际上被善用。在一个信任是关键的世界,我们越来越互相联系,那些未能沟通和可视化其影响的组织将落后。

- Kevin O'Brien,Kiva首席技术官

 


虚拟现实


     对于虚拟现实(VR),2017年是内容成为焦点的一年。硬件制造商将激励内容创作者,将增加对VR内容的投资,这在很大程度上是由亚洲投资者。在硬件方面,像HTC,Google,Oculus等制造商将继续重复他们的VR技术,侧重于计算效率和增加移动性。

- Richard Enlow,Pivotal产品设计实践部产品设计和经理

 


工作场所


     你会有一个小军队的机器人,以帮助你做你的工作。随着企业从电子邮件转向消息传递,您用于工作的所有软件都将与最普遍的工作消息产品连接。随着每个企业和初创公司在2011年移动,机器人是下一个主要趋势。随着邮箱,日历和其他移动优先的生产力应用程序上升,将有一个趋势,在2017年热门机器人工作的公司上升。最大的问题在于这些小助手需要是多么聪明:做机器人需要了解您的每一个要求?他们能够智能地收集你的需要,还是我们会满意他们的存在以满足特定的功能?如果成功需要智能,主要的玩家- 谷歌,微软,IBM和Facebook - 相对于小型开发者来说具有显着的优势。

-  Ceci Stallsmith,Slack平台市场经理

 

Rob Mee

Pivotal的首席执行官


注:本文翻译自英文博客文章:https://content.pivotal.io/blog/software-trends-for-2017   



更多精彩内容,请点击阅读原文”进行查看!

如何每天都能收到如此精彩的文章?

①点击右上角点击查看官方账号”→点击关注

②长按并识别下图中的二维码,直接访问EMC中文支持论坛


 
戴尔易安信技术支持 更多文章 EMC Unity启用压缩时的建议和最佳实践 VMAX全闪存集成CloudArray 【声音】叶成辉谈新常态下外资科技公司在中国的角色 【存储入门必读】SAN网络性能问题排错指南 【存储入门必读】存储性能瓶颈的成因、定位与排查
猜您喜欢 系列:知名互联网公司都在使用哪些数据库? | 第二弹 流式处理架构的“瓶颈”:数据访问(上) Python | 你不可不知的“黑魔法” Android逆向之旅---Android中的GG大玩家应用破解教程分析 [重磅报告] 波士顿咨询:零售银行在互联网下的生存法则(附下载)